Output 597628fbbc8be4dfc6170dd7b16a4469acaee98d14b6f898c727f227a84b0575:0

value
3998735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4a8826ef6c121e22ddfae400a2c917a8b12476 OP_EQUAL
address
M9CiygLqo6ZcVtedqEP7G2enGTcYJMhw1F
transaction
597628fbbc8be4dfc6170dd7b16a4469acaee98d14b6f898c727f227a84b0575
spent
true